WATERLOO, Ont. (January 8, 2010) -
Elizabeth Kench of Gananoque, Ont., provided all the offence, scoring a hatrick as the Queen's Gaels downed the Waterloo Warriors 3-0. The win was the women's hockey team's first of the new year as they make their push toward the OUA playoffs.
Kench opened the scoring for the Gaels with a goal four minutes into the game.
Becky Conroy of Pembroke, Ont., had an assist on the goal which would be her first of three in the game as she assisted all three of Kench's goals. Kench would add her second goal with two minutes remaining in the second period before scoring her third on the power play in the third period.
Calgary's
Karissa Savage stopped all 17 shots she faced in goal for the Gaels to preserve the shutout.
Alex Cieslowski of Oakville, Ont.,
Morgan McHaffie of Guelph, Ont., and
Kelsey Thomson of Martintown, Ont. added an assist each.
The Gaels return to action on Sunday, January 9 when they take on the no.2 Wilfrid Laurier Golden Hawks. Puck drop is set for 3:00 pm in Waterloo.
